Ratenberg Font for Creative Projects

There I was, holding a jar of beeswax candles, thinking about how to make the label stand out. I wanted something that felt personal, elegant, and just a little bit whimsical. That’s when I discovered Ratenberg—a modern script font that brought my vision to life. With its flowing lines and soft curves, it felt like a handwriting style made for design.

Ratenberg for Candle Labels and Handmade Packaging

Ratenberg is a modern script font that adds a touch of personality to any handmade product. I’ve used it on candle labels, where the delicate strokes give each jar a unique, artisanal feel. Whether I’m labeling a lavender-scented soy candle or a peppermint-infused beeswax one, Ratenberg makes the text look like it was written by hand, not typed on a keyboard.

When designing packaging, I often pair Ratenberg with a clean sans serif font for balance. The contrast helps the main message pop without overwhelming the eye. It works well for small tags, product boxes, and even custom stickers that I use as part of my shop’s branding.

Ratenberg for Greeting Cards and Wedding Invitations

One of my favorite uses for Ratenberg has been in greeting cards. Whether I’m creating a birthday card or a thank-you note, the font gives the text a warm, inviting tone. I love how it looks on folded cards, especially when paired with simple illustrations or watercolor accents.

For wedding invitations, Ratenberg brings an air of sophistication. I’ve used it for save-the-dates, RSVP cards, and welcome signs at events. The font feels timeless yet modern, making it perfect for both rustic and elegant weddings. It also works well for farmhouse-style signs, adding a handwritten charm to any space.

Ratenberg for Tote Bags and Apparel Design

I recently designed a set of tote bags for a seasonal sale, and Ratenberg was the perfect choice for the text. It looked great on fabric, whether printed in bold black or in a soft pastel shade. The font’s flow made the words feel natural, like they were part of the design rather than an afterthought.

On t-shirts and hoodies, Ratenberg adds a personal touch. I’ve used it for names, short quotes, and even custom logos. The font is readable enough for small text but still has that artistic flair that makes it stand out. It pairs well with minimalist designs, allowing the font to be the focal point.

Ratenberg for Digital Printables and Wall Art

As a printable creator, I often turn to Ratenberg for wall art and planner pages. Its fluid style makes it ideal for quotes, affirmations, and decorative text. I’ve used it in downloadable printables for home decor, journaling prompts, and social media graphics.

When working on digital templates, Ratenberg adds a creative edge. It works well for headers, titles, and section dividers. I’ve paired it with a bold display font for headlines and a simple serif font for body text, creating a balanced and professional look.
